Transaction 51fcaac43f72216157dcd7e02f4a827d4b9585803a3acd8745087d3f1ed22c62

1 Input
2 Outputs
  • 51fcaac43f72216157dcd7e02f4a827d4b9585803a3acd8745087d3f1ed22c62:0
  • value  5253950
    address  3EsYkWRbQGzYNLREBZkLUS4NfJqGMDqHiA
  • 51fcaac43f72216157dcd7e02f4a827d4b9585803a3acd8745087d3f1ed22c62:1
  • value  7043634
    address  1JRSWYiG7i95tkjuZgoZnxZW417DaDFqR5